Mandiant Details Cisco SD-WAN Zero-Day Exploit That Created Root Accounts

By Meridian48 News Desk · Summarised from Bleeping Computer ·

Hackers exploited CVE-2026-20245, a zero-day in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N, to create rogue root accounts on targeted devices. Mandiant revealed the attack chain, which bypassed authentication and gained full system control. Cisco has released patches, but unpatched devices remain at risk.
